toutes les options
stretch  ] [  buster  ] [  bullseye  ] [  bookworm  ] [  sid  ]
[ Paquet source : clojure  ]

Paquet : clojure (1.10.2-1)

Liens pour clojure

Screenshot

Ressources Debian :

Télécharger le paquet source clojure :

Responsables :

Ressources externes :

Paquets similaires :

dialecte Lisp pour la JVM

Clojure est un langage de programmation dynamique ciblant la machine virtuelle Java. Il est conçu pour être un langage généraliste combinant l'accessibilité et le développement interactif d'un langage de script avec une infrastructure efficace et robuste pour la programmation multiprocessus. Clojure est un langage compilé – il compile directement en code objet de la JVM, tout en restant complètement dynamique. Chaque fonctionnalité prise en charge par Clojure est gérée lors de l'exécution. Clojure fournit un accès simple aux environnements Java avec des suggestions de type optionnelles et une inférence de type, pour assurer que les appels à Java puissent éviter la réflexion.

Clojure est un dialecte de Lisp et partage avec Lisp la philosophie de code en tant que donnée et un puissant système de macro. Clojure est principalement un langage de programmation fonctionnelle et fournit un ensemble riche de structures de données non mutables et persistantes. Quand un état mutable est nécessaire, Clojure offre un système de mémoire transactionnelle et un système d'agent réactif qui assurent des conceptions multiprocessus propres et correctes.

Autres paquets associés à clojure

  • dépendances
  • recommandations
  • suggestions
  • enhances

Télécharger clojure

Télécharger pour toutes les architectures proposées
Architecture Taille du paquet Espace occupé une fois installé Fichiers
all 52,6 ko94,0 ko [liste des fichiers]